PC Building Simulator, the educational game with the pleasingly self-explanatory title, could soon be teaching a whole new generation to be more hardware-literate. Its publishers say they've been approached by teachers keen to get the game into schools.

Stuart Morton, producer at publishers The Irregular Corporation, tells PC Games Insider that "We're getting a lot of requests - daily - to get the game into classrooms as part of the curriculum to do classes about building PCs in IT."
